The Systemic Erosion of Command Signals
Your physiology operates as a highly sophisticated, interconnected control system. The endocrine axis ∞ the Hypothalamic-Pituitary-Gonadal (HPG) axis, the Somatotropic axis, the Adrenal axis ∞ are the wiring and programming dictating cellular behavior. As decades accumulate, the output from the central command structure ∞ the hypothalamus and pituitary ∞ decrements.
Growth Hormone (GH) secretion amplitude drops significantly after the third decade of life, affecting lean mass and bone density maintenance. Simultaneously, the gonadal output in men experiences a gradual but undeniable descent in testosterone, a master regulator of drive, mood, and tissue anabolism.
This decline is not merely cosmetic. Lowered sex hormones correlate with measurable deficits in mental acuity. Low endogenous testosterone in older men is associated with poorer performance across several cognitive domains, including verbal fluency and executive function. Recalibrating the Somatotropic Axis
The decline in Growth Hormone (GH) and its mediator, Insulin-like Growth Factor 1 (IGF-1), directly compromises tissue repair and body composition. Direct GH replacement carries systemic risks that sophisticated practitioners avoid. The superior method involves signaling the body to produce its own pulsatile release, mimicking youthful physiology. This is achieved through the strategic application of Growth Hormone Secretagogues (GHS) and Growth Hormone Releasing Hormones (GHRH) analogs.

The Precision of Molecular Messengers
Hormone Replacement Therapy (HRT) restores the primary structural elements ∞ testosterone, estrogen, thyroid function ∞ to optimal, high-performance ranges, addressing the systemic framework. Peptides function as the fine-tuning adjustments. They are short amino acid chains delivering specific instructions to cells, a level of biological communication that conventional pharmacology often lacks. They address secondary aging factors ∞ inflammation, cellular senescence, and telomere attrition.
The implementation requires rigorous diagnostic mapping. One does not simply dose; one titrates based on comprehensive biomarker analysis, including sex hormones, SHBG, free fractions, cortisol metabolites, and advanced metabolic panels. This diagnostic-driven approach separates performance optimization from mere symptom management.
